Whats the issue? In February 2022 Veteran environmentalist Ravi Chopra has resigned as chairman of the Supreme Courts High Powered Committee (HPC) on the Char Dham project saying that his belief that the HPC could protect this fragile (Himalayan) ecology has been shattered.In his resignation letter to the secretary general of the Supreme Court on January 27 Chopra referred to the apex courts December 2021 order that accepted the wider road configuration to meet defence needs instead of what the HPC had recommended and the SC accepted in its earlier order in September 2020.  6 What has the Court said so far in this matter?In 2018 the project was challenged by an NGO for its potential impact on the Himalayan ecology due to felling trees cutting hills and dumping excavated material.In 2019 the SC formed the HPC Chopra to examine the issues and in September 2020 accepted his recommendation on road width etc.In November 2020 the ministry of Defence sought wider roads to meet the requirement of the Army.In December 2021 the SC modified its September 2020 order on the ground that the court could not interrogate the policy choice of the establishment which is entrusted by law with the defence of the nation. About Chardham projectThe project involves developing and widening nearly 900 km of national highways connecting the holy Hindu pilgrimage sites of Badrinath Kedarnath Gangotri and Yamunotri at an estimated cost of Rs.12000 crores shine india subscription buy.
